Roland Lavantureux
Roland Lavantureux, a second-generation winemaker, was the first to bottle the estate’s wines: Domaine Roland Lavantureux was founded in 1979. Today, his two sons, Arnaud and David, have taken over the reins.

Together, they have expanded Domaine Roland Lavantureux: the cellar was enlarged in 2012, a family estate (on the mother’s side) in Bourgogne Epineuil and Bourgogne Tonnerre was taken over, and new plots were acquired in Chablis Premier Cru Vau de Vey.

Domaine Roland Lavantureux produces Chablis wines while respecting the identity of each of its terroirs. Thus, the wine range includes Petit Chablis, three types of Chablis, Chablis Premier Cru Fourchaume and Vau de Vay, and Chablis Grand Cru Vaudésir and Bougros.
